How Vencid DSR 30mg/40mg Tablet works:
Each Vencid DSR 30mg/40mg tablet contains Domperidone and Pantoprazole, working synergistically to alleviate digestive discomfort. Domperidone, a prokinetic agent, enhances upper gastrointestinal motility, facilitating efficient food passage. Pantoprazole, a proton pump inhibitor (PPI), lowers stomach acid production, providing relief from acid indigestion and heartburn symptoms.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holCAUTION
Use of Vencid DSR 30mg/40mg tablets with alcohol requires careful consideration. Seek medical advice before combining them.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of Vencid DSR 30mg/40mg t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scant, animal studies indicate pot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the advantages against possible risks prior to prescribing. Patient consultation with their doctor is advised.
Breast feedingCAUTION
The use of Vencid DSR 30mg/40mg tablets while breastfeeding requires careful consideration. Mothers should discontinue breastfeeding for the duration of their treatment and until the medication is fully cleared from their system.
DrivingUNSAFE
Taking Vencid DSR 30mg/40mg tablets might reduce alertness, impair vision, and cause drowsiness or dizziness. Refrain from driving if you experience these effects.
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with kidney impairment should use Vencid DSR 30mg/40mg Tablets cautiously, as d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.
Li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The use of Vencid DSR 30mg/40mg tablets in individuals with hepatic impairment is likely safe. Existing evidence indicates that dosage modification may not be necessary for this patient group. However, medical advice should be sought.
What if you forget to take Vencid DSR 30mg/40mg Tablet :
Should you forget a Vencid DSR 30mg/40mg Tablet dose, administer it at your earliest convenience.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
